Abstract

Multiple sclerosis (MS) is an immune-mediated neurodegenerative disease of the central nervous system (CNS), which leads to demyelination, axonal loss, and neurodegeneration. Increased oxidative stress and neurodegeneration have been implicated in all stages of MS, making neuroprotective therapeutics a promising strategy for its treatment. We previously have reported vinyl sulfones with antioxidative and anti-inflammatory properties that activate nuclear factor erythroid 2-related factor 2 (Nrf2), a transcription factor that induces the expression of cytoprotective genes against oxidative stress. In this study, we synthesized vinyl sulfoximine derivatives by modifying the core structure and determined therapeutic potential as Nrf2 activators. Among them, 10v effectively activated Nrf2 (EC50 = 83.5 nM) and exhibited favorable drug-like properties. 10v successfully induced expression of Nrf2-dependent antioxidant Enzymes and suppressed lipopolysaccharide (LPS)-induced inflammatory responses in BV-2 microglial cells. We also confirmed that 10v effectively reversed disease progression and attenuated demyelination in an experimental autoimmune encephalitis (EAE) mouse model of MS.
